It is with profound sadness that we announce the sudden passing on December 27 of Kathleen (Ferguson) DellaGhelfa, lifelong resident of Torrington. Born in 1950 to her beloved parents Garvin and Lillian Ferguson, she graduated from Torrington High School and immediately went on to pursue a career in nursing, a profession most suited to her giving, selfless nature. Kathy (as she was known to all) spent her entire career at Charlotte Hungerford Hospital where she performed nursing care that seemed unlikely, even miraculous, given her diminutive stature. She retired after a long career as a pharmacy technician at the hospital.
She is survived by her son Daren, her loving sisters Denice Percivalle (John) and Judy Sabia (Rock), her granddaughter Kayla, and four great-grandchildren, Shawn, Saint, Santino, and TJ with whom she just celebrated Christmas. She will be missed as well by her nieces and nephews, and especially by a small group of lifelong friends who will miss her laughter at their gatherings. She was predeceased by her ex-husband Gary, her parents Garvin and Lillian, grandparents Joseph and Victoria Dzialo, and recently by a most cherished friend, Nick Corvo. The world has lost a most beautiful spirit in Kathy, one of the kindest, most gentle souls to walk among us. The new year will be darker for us without her light. Kathy was a lover of nature, a writer of poetry, and kindness personified. To honor her memory, consider walking in the woods and thinking of her, writing a note to a loved one, or extending an act of kindness to a stranger.
Calling hours will be held at Phalen's Funeral Home, 285 Migeon Avenue, Torrington, CT on Thursday, January 4 from 10:30 to 12:00. A brief cemetery service at St. Peter's Cemetery will follow.
